What chin shape is most attractive? This question has intrigued both scientists and aestheticians for years. The chin, often considered a defining feature of the face, plays a significant role in determining one’s overall attractiveness. While beauty is subjective and varies across cultures, certain chin shapes have been consistently regarded as more aesthetically pleasing than others.
The ideal chin shape, according to many experts, is one that balances the face harmoniously. A well-defined chin can enhance the facial features and contribute to a more attractive appearance. One of the most sought-after chin shapes is the V-shaped chin, often associated with celebrities and models. This type of chin is characterized by a pronounced point at the chin’s tip, creating a vertical line that is believed to be more appealing to the human eye.
Another popular chin shape is the U-shaped chin, which is characterized by a gradual curve from the jawline to the chin. This shape is often considered to be more balanced and proportional, making it a favorite among many. The U-shaped chin is believed to provide a more harmonious balance to the face, contributing to its attractiveness.
On the other hand, a square chin is often seen as less attractive. This type of chin is characterized by a straight line from the jawline to the chin, which can create an unbalanced look. However, it’s important to note that a square chin can still be attractive if it is well-proportioned and balanced with the rest of the facial features.
Facial symmetry is another crucial factor in determining attractiveness. A symmetrical chin, with equal distances between the chin’s tip and the jawline, is often considered more aesthetically pleasing. This symmetry can create a more balanced and harmonious appearance, making the face more attractive.
It’s worth mentioning that attractiveness is not solely determined by the shape of the chin. Other facial features, such as the eyes, nose, and lips, also play a significant role. Additionally, personal preferences and cultural norms can greatly influence one’s perception of attractiveness.
In conclusion, while there is no definitive answer to what chin shape is most attractive, certain shapes, such as the V-shaped and U-shaped chins, are often regarded as more aesthetically pleasing. It’s important to remember that beauty is subjective, and what may be attractive to one person may not be to another. Ultimately, the most attractive chin shape is one that is balanced, proportional, and harmonious with the rest of the facial features.
